Peering Beneath the Sands: The Power of Excavation Tools

Excavation in arid desert environments relies heavily on precision and care. The digger—a construct often resembling a sturdy spade or mechanical excavator—allows archaeologists to carefully remove centuries of sediment, unearthing artifacts, tombs, and architectural remnants. Rather than brute force, this work demands an expert’s touch, balancing excavation speed with preservation integrity. The importance of specialized tools cannot be overstated in maintaining the contextual integrity of discoveries, which in turn fortify their scholarly value.

Understanding the technological evolution of excavation tools illuminates how modern archaeology maximizes both efficiency and scientific accuracy.
